Roosevelt Row is a vibrant arts district located in downtown Phoenix, Arizona. It is known for its creative community, street art, galleries, and entertainment options.

The neighborhood stretches along Roosevelt Street, between 7th Street and Central Avenue. It was originally a residential area in the early 1900s, but in recent years it has become a hub for artists and entrepreneurs, with a focus on sustainability and community development.

The area is home to numerous galleries and studios, showcasing works by local artists in a variety of media, including painting, sculpture, and photography. There are also a number of performance spaces, music venues, and independent theaters.

Roosevelt Row is particularly well-known for its vibrant street art scene. Visitors can explore the many murals and public art installations that adorn the walls of buildings throughout the neighborhood, many of which are created by local artists.

In addition to the arts, Roosevelt Row offers a wide range of dining and entertainment options. Visitors can enjoy everything from craft cocktails and gourmet cuisine to live music and stand-up comedy.

Overall, Roosevelt Row is a dynamic and creative neighborhood that offers a unique glimpse into Phoenix's thriving arts and culture scene.

What are Real Estate Incentives?

Real Estate incentives range widely and have been overlooked by the Commercial Multiple Listing Services (MLS) for decades. Real estate incentives is a generic term used to group any number of programs, such as tax incentives, that are designated by an agency for a geographic area."

Why are Real Estate Incentives Important and to Whom?

"Incentives" are vital today and in the future because:

  • U.S. Public: Many incentives focus on job creation and Affordable Housing
  • Investors and Commercial Developers use incentives to reduce financial risk, obtain gap financing, etc. Investors and developers look for property listings with incentives available.
  • Commercial Real Estate Brokers, in mass, unfortunately do not know about incentives tied to their listings
  • Entire Supply Chain of Real Estate Development such as small and large companies who will provide goods and services to new and revitalized properties.
